Thanks for the explanation, making a better seal has improved my percussion, I’ve got a question though. When you actually strike with the finger is it done with tip or the flat (fingerprint area) of the finger? It’s always looked to me like the tip is being used but I sometimes find it can be painful with my nails digging into the back of my other hand (my nails aren’t particularly long for context).
@DrStefanCristianStanel
@DrStefanCristianStanel 7 ай бұрын
tip of the finger is better, just try to practice it gets less painful and will start to feel easy after a while. it's just as if you would be tapping with your fingers on a table

Thank you for this! I think it would be really helpful if you could show us how it sounds on an actual patient and the difference between dullness and percussion. I have troubles percussing the upper span of the liver for example as I have difficulty differentiating the sound from the intercostal spaces and when I actually reach the liver span. Thank you for your time!
@XalipsX
@XalipsX Жыл бұрын
It is actually not that hard. Try it on you colleague in front of the supervisor/doctor or anyone with experience. As they will guide you and inform you if you missed the dullness You determine the upper edge of the liver, when the resonance starts changing to dullness, it will not change immediately from resonance to clear dullness. In another way, it will be resonance but not as clear as usual(resonance mixed with dullness) Try it many times and you will get it easily
